Electrical Design Engineer - Building Services
Location: Birmingham
Hours: Day Shift
Salary: Competitive, based on experience
Reporting to: Head of Design

About the Employer

A well-established organisation operating across the UK and Europe is seeking an Electrical Design Engineer to join their growing team. The company specialises in the design, manufacture, and delivery of prefabricated mechanical and electrical building services solutions, with a strong focus on sustainability and innovation. Their projects span multiple sectors including healthcare, education, leisure, and residential developments.

Role Overview

This role offers the opportunity to contribute to the development of low-carbon infrastructure through the design of electrical systems for energy centres and district heating schemes. You'll be involved in producing build-ready designs using industry-standard software and collaborating with multidisciplinary teams to deliver high-quality, coordinated solutions.

Responsibilities

Conduct site surveys to assess existing services and integration options.
Produce electrical design drawings, specifications, and cable routing plans across all project phases.
Develop control panel schematics and operational descriptions for building management systems (BMS).
Ensure designs comply with relevant health, safety, and quality standards.
Attend design meetings and liaise with internal and external stakeholders.
Support commissioning teams with BMS control integration and testing.
Occasional travel across the UK may be required.Requirements

HNC/HND or equivalent in Electrical or Control Engineering.
Minimum 3 years' experience in building services design.
Proficiency with electrical design software (e.g. Amtech, Electrical OM).
Strong understanding of industry regulations and best practices.
Excellent communication, organisation, and attention to detail.
Ability to work independently and meet deadlines.Desirable Skills

Experience in commercial M&E design.
Familiarity with AutoCAD, MEP, Revit, or similar software.Benefits
